A guitar neck is usually made from wood, most commonly maple or mahogany. Inside the neck there will be a metal truss rod that stops the wood from bending out of shape.

What are the different types of materials used for constructing a guitar neck fingerboard?

The different types of materials used for constructing a guitar neck fingerboard include rosewood, maple, ebony, and synthetic materials like composite and resin. Each material has unique characteristics that can affect the sound and playability of the guitar.

What are the different types of materials used to make a guitar neck with strings?

The different types of materials used to make a guitar neck with strings include wood, such as maple, mahogany, and rosewood, as well as synthetic materials like carbon fiber. These materials are chosen for their strength, durability, and ability to resonate sound effectively.

What is the neck of the guitar called?

The neck of a guitar as no other name than that -- the neck. This is the part of the guitar that connects the body to the head of the instrument. Located on the neck are the frets and the fretboard. In addition, all of the guitar strings rest slightly above the fretboard. In short, "the neck" is already a technical term. It doesn't have a special name to make it sound fancier.


What are the different types of guitar dots used for marking fret positions on a guitar neck?

The different types of guitar dots used for marking fret positions on a guitar neck are typically made of materials like plastic, mother of pearl, or metal. They are placed on the fretboard at specific intervals to help guitarists easily identify and navigate different fret positions while playing.
